Wide flange beams (W shapes / I-beams) are the most common structural steel profile used in building construction. They are used for beams, columns, and girders in steel-framed buildings and bridges. Designed per AISC 360, Eurocode 3, and NBR 8800.

Also known as: VS 350x51 (México) · Doble T VS 350x51 (Argentina / LATAM) · UB 350 (UK / Australia)

The VS 350x51 steel profile weighs 51.3 kg/m (34.47 lb/ft), has a depth of 350 mm (13.78 in), flange width 200 mm (7.87 in). Cross-sectional area: 6,543.8 mm². Moment of inertia Ix = 15,603.61 cm⁴, Iy = 1,666.96 cm⁴.

Dimensions

PropertyMetricImperial
Depth (h)350 mm13.78 in
Width (b)200 mm7.87 in
Web thickness (tw)4.8 mm0.19 in
Flange thickness (tf)12.5 mm0.49 in
Weight51.3 kg/m34.47 lb/ft

Section Properties

PropertyMetricImperial
Area (A)6,543.8 mm²10.143 in²
Moment of inertia (Ix)15,603.61 cm⁴374.88 in⁴
Moment of inertia (Iy)1,666.96 cm⁴40.05 in⁴
Elastic section modulus (Sx)891.64 cm³54.411 in³
Elastic section modulus (Sy)166.7 cm³10.173 in³
Plastic section modulus (Zx)969.18 cm³59.143 in³
Plastic section modulus (Zy)251.83 cm³15.368 in³
Radius of gyration (rx)15.44 cm6.079 in
Radius of gyration (ry)5.05 cm1.988 in
